Niger General Tchiani Named Head Of Transitional Government After Coup

The chief of the Presidential Guard of Niger; General Abdourahamane Tchiani, has been named “president of the National Council for the Safeguard of the Homeland,” following a military takeover, state television reported on Friday.

General Abdourahamane Tchiani, the Presidential Guard’s commander since 2011, claims the takeover is a reaction to “the degradation of the security situation” brought on by Islamist violence.

Elected President Mohamed Bazoum is still being detained by army putschists since Wednesday morning.

A statement followed by the putschists on TV warned of “the consequences that will flow from any foreign military intervention”.

“Certain dignitaries .. are in thinking of confrontation” which “will end in nothing but the massacre of the Nigerien population and chaos,” they claimed.

On the third day since President Mohamed Bazoum was detained, former colonial master France demanded the restoration of the democratically elected government saying it “does not recognize” the putschists, and calling Bazoum “sole president”.

The coup has prompted mounting international concern, and on Friday Kenyan President William Ruto called the army takeover “a serious setback” for Africa.

“The aspirations of the people of Niger for constitutional democracy were subverted by an unconstitutional change of government,” he said in a video message.

The European Union threatened to cut aid to Niamey after what it said was a “serious attack on stability and democracy” in Niger.

Bazoum and his family have been confined since Wednesday morning to their residence at the presidential palace located within the Guard’s military camp.

He is said to be in good health and has been able to talk by telephone to other heads of state.
